What Are Energy Efficient Windows

Energy efficient windows are built to keep heat inside your home during winter and outside during summer. They use special glass, insulated frames, and sealed air gaps to stop heat from escaping.

Standard single-pane windows let heat pass straight through the glass. That heat loss forces your boiler to work harder, which pushes up your heating bills month after month. An energy efficient window tackles this problem at the source by slowing down heat transfer.

How Window Energy Loss Actually Happens

Heat does not just vanish from your home. It moves through three paths: the glass, the frame, and the gaps where air leaks through.

  • Glass conducts heat directly unless treated with special coatings
  • Frames made from poor materials transfer heat just like the glass does
  • Gaps and worn seals let warm air escape and cold air rush in

Once you understand these three paths, the rest of this guide will make a lot more sense.

Double Glazed Windows vs Triple Glazed Windows

This is the question we get asked the most. Should you choose double glazed windows or go further with triple glazed windows?

Double and triple glazed windows both use multiple panes of glass with a gap between them. That gap traps air or gas, which acts as an extra layer of insulation. A single pane simply cannot do this job alone.

Double Glazed Windows

Double glazed windows use two panes of glass with a sealed gap in between. This is the standard choice for most UK homes and offers a strong balance between cost and performance.

  • Reduces noise from outside traffic
  • Cuts heat loss by roughly half compared to single glazing
  • Lowers condensation on the inside of the glass
  • Works well in most UK climates, including colder regions

Triple Glazed Windows

Triple glazed windows add a third pane of glass, creating two insulating gaps instead of one. This gives you better thermal insulation and is a smart pick if you live somewhere particularly cold or noisy.

The downside is cost. Triple glazing usually costs more upfront than double glazing. For most homes, double glazing already meets building regulations and delivers strong savings. Triple glazing makes more sense for north-facing rooms, homes near busy roads, or properties in exposed rural areas.

The Role of Low-E Glass and Coatings

Low-E Glass, short for low emissivity glass, is one of the biggest reasons modern windows perform so well. It has a microscopically thin metallic coating that reflects heat back into the room while still letting light through.

This iron glass coating works in both directions. In winter, it bounces indoor heat back inside. In summer, it reflects outdoor heat away, helping your home stay cooler without extra air conditioning.

Frame Material Matters Just as Much as Glass

People focus heavily on glass, but the frame material plays an equally important role in thermal performance. A great pane of glass set in a poor frame still leaks heat.

Common Frame Materials Compared

uPVC frames are the most popular choice in the UK. They are affordable, low maintenance, and offer solid insulation. They rarely need painting and hold up well against UK weather.

Aluminium frames look sleek and modern but conduct heat faster than uPVC unless they include a thermal break, a strip of insulating material inside the frame.

Timber frames offer excellent natural insulation and a classic look, though they need more upkeep over time, including occasional repainting or resealing.

Composite frames combine timber on the inside with aluminium or another material outside, giving you good looks with lower maintenance.

Whatever frame you choose, ask your installer about its insulation rating. The frame can make up nearly a third of the total window area, so it has a real impact on performance.

Understanding Window Energy Ratings

Not all windows perform the same, which is why the UK uses a rating system to compare them. Window energy ratings run from A++ down to E, similar to the labels you see on fridges and washing machines.

This system is managed through the British Fenestration Rating Council, often shortened to BFRC. The rating looks at three things together: how much heat the window lets in from the sun, how much heat it loses, and how much air leaks through the frame.

How to Read a Window Energy Rating

  • A++ and A rated windows offer the best thermal performance available
  • B and C rated windows still perform reasonably well for most homes
  • D and below indicate older or lower quality glazing that loses more heat

When you compare quotes, always ask for the BFRC rating in writing. Some installers quote vague terms like “energy efficient” without backing it up with an actual certified rating.

Beyond Bills: Comfort and Property Value

Lower heating bills are not the only benefit. Upgrading also means:

  • Fewer cold spots near windows in winter
  • Less condensation buildup, which protects window frames and sills
  • A smaller carbon footprint for your household
  • Increased kerb appeal and resale value for your property

Energy performance certificates (EPCs) factor in window quality, so an upgrade can improve your home’s EPC rating too. This matters more than ever, since EPC ratings increasingly influence both resale value and mortgage terms in the UK.

Signs You Need to Replace Your Windows Now

You do not need to wait for windows to fail completely before upgrading. Watch for these warning signs.

Common Red Flags

  • Condensation forming between the panes, not just on the surface
  • Drafts you can feel near the frame even when windows are shut
  • Difficulty opening or closing windows smoothly
  • Visible gaps, cracks, or warping in the frame
  • Single glazing anywhere in the house, especially in older properties

If you notice two or more of these signs, it is worth getting a professional assessment rather than waiting for a full breakdown.

Frequently Asked Questions

Are energy efficient windows worth the cost?

Yes, for most UK homes. The combination of lower heating bills, improved comfort, and increased property value usually outweighs the upfront cost over the lifespan of the windows.

What is the best frame material for insulation?

uPVC and composite frames generally offer the best balance of insulation, cost, and low maintenance for most UK homes. Timber offers excellent natural insulation but needs more upkeep.

Do triple glazed windows make sense for every home?

Not always. They make the most sense for colder regions, noisy locations, or north-facing rooms. Standard double glazing already meets most UK homes’ needs.

How do I check a window’s true energy rating?

Ask your installer for the BFRC certified energy label, which runs from A++ to E and reflects heat loss, solar gain, and air leakage together.
